Darrell Dean Anderson

August 8, 1941 — March 7, 2011

Darrell "Dean" Anderson, 69, of Pratt, Kansas, and formerly of Dayton, Iowa, passed away Monday, March 7, 2011, at Lakewood Senior Living in Pratt.

Funeral services will be held 10:30 a.m., Friday, March 11, 2011, at Carson - Stapp Funeral Home in Ogden. Rev. Rod Meyer will officiate. Burial will be in the Pilot Mound Cemetery. Visitation will be Thursday, from 5:00 to 7:00 p.m., at Carson - Stapp Funeral Home in Ogden.

Darrell Dean Anderson was born on August 8, 1941, in Boone, Iowa the son of Clifford and Mabel (Johnson) Anderson. He graduated in 1959 from Grand Community High School in Boxholm. On February 2, 1964, Dean married Judy Anderson with whom he had four children. Dean started working part time during high school for the coop system at the Beaver Coop Elevator. Following his education, he worked full time for various coops in Iowa until 1973 when he was promoted to Assistant Manager and then to Branch Manager/Grain Merchandise for the Boone Coop in 1974. He worked as General Manager in Iowa, Colorado, Missouri, Oklahoma, and Kansas, from 1977 to 1998. On November 26, 1982, Dean was united in marriage to Karen Nelson at Emanuel Lutheran Church in Dayton. Prior to retirement, Dean worked as Interim Manager setting up mergers for coops in Northern Kansas and Southern Wisconsin, from 1998 to December of 2000. He retired in the community of St. John, Kansas, in December of 2000. After suffering a stroke in June of 2002, Dean has resided at the Lakewood Senior Living Center in Pratt, Kansas.

Survivors include his wife of 29 years, Karen Anderson of St. John, Kansas; one son, Gary Anderson of Oskaloosa, Iowa; three daughters, Cathy (Don) Nyren of Harcourt, Iowa, Sue (Richard) Travis of Dayton, Iowa, and Jody Anderson of Des Moines, Iowa; three step-children, Dan Nelson of Justin, Texas, Susan (Craig) Cooper of Dayton, Iowa, and Daren Nelson of Ottumwa, Iowa; nine grandchildren; two great grandchildren; one brother, Charles (Emily) Anderson of Story City, Iowa; a niece, Kay Anderson, and a nephew, Tom Anderson. He was preceded in death by his parents, Clifford and Mabel Anderson.
